WebFeb 3, 2024 · As we have said ‘subsidence’ in clay soils tends to be cyclical with shrinkage and expansion taking place on a seasonal basis. Heave is likely to be progressive, as the clay will take up moisture following tree removal until it finds a new equilibrium. This can result in upward movement of foundations over a number of years with the damage ... For example, in clay of low to medium shrinkage potential, or in … oundle co op opening timesWebExpansive clay presents engineers and owners of lightly loaded structures with significant design challenges. Because of the potential for foundation movement, expansive clay must be dealt with by some means. While a structurally suspended floor provides the most positive solution to the potential for heave, it is often cost prohibitive. rod tanchancoWebOver 50 percent of these areas are underlain by soils with abundant clays of high swelling potential.
